   Hello Train Fans

Some of you might know me as a builder of heavy equipment like cranes or mining shovels.

Here I would like to present my first train MOC, an EMD F7 of the Australian Mt. Newman Mining Company.



The real loco has been hauling iron ore cars for several years and is now retired and on display at the Pilbara Railways Museum:



Although there are already lots of LEGO-built F7s, I still like the design of that specific type. Therefore I searched for a color scheme that has not yet been copied with LEGO bricks and that was possible to recreate with the parts in my collection.

The model is fully capable of negotiating curves and switches. A new feature are the step ladders on the locomotive frame in the region of the trucks using old style windows. They swing away in curves and therefore make room for the trucks to swing out.

Welcome to trains, Beat! That’s quite a nice F7, the colour scheme is nicely done. I like the bogies, and those windows look great for ladders.

The only downside I can see is the coupler attached to the frame, which tends to cause problems when cornering, if the couplers on your rolling stock are attached to the bogies.
